Factors Affecting Cost

  • Material Choice: The type of materials used, such as concrete, pavers, or natural stone, can significantly impact the overall cost.
  • Size of Patio: Larger patios require more materials and labor, increasing the total expense.
  • Hot Tub Type: Different hot tubs come with varying price tags based on features, size, and brand.
  •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Annapolis, MD, can vary, affecting the overall project cost.
  • Site Preparation: The condition of your yard, including grading and leveling, can add to the cost.
  • Permits and Inspections: Fees for necessary permits and inspections can also influence the total cost.
  • Additional Features: Extras like lighting, seating, or landscaping will add to the budget.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Annapolis, MD)
Basic Patio Installation $2,500 - $5,000
Hot Tub Purchase $3,000 - $10,000
Electrical Work $500 - $1,500
Plumbing Work $300 - $1,000
Site Preparation $1,000 - $3,000
Permits and Inspections $100 - $500
Additional Features $500 - $2,000
